#FD216A Color
#FD216A is rgb(253, 33, 106) in RGB, hsl(340, 98%, 56%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 87%, 58%, 1%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Vivid Raspberry (#FF006C), very hard to tell apart at ΔE 4.23.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#FD216A Channel Values
How #FD216A bre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 253 · G 33 · B 106 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 340° · S 98% · L 56%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 340° · S 87% · V 99%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 0% · M 87% · Y 58% · K 1%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 3.75:1 vs white · 5.6: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#FD216A background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#FD216A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#FD216A?
#FD216A is a mid-tone pink — rgb(253, 33, 106) in RGB and hsl(340, 98%, 56%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Vivid Raspberry (#FF006C), which is very hard to tell apart at a CIE76 distance of 4.23.
What is the RGB value of #FD216A?
#FD216A is rgb(253, 33, 106) — red 253, green 33, and blue 106 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#FD216A?
#FD216A conver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 87%, 58%, 1%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#FD216A be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#FD216A scores 3.75:1 against white and 5.6: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#FD216A as a CSS color keyword?
No. #FD216A is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is crimson (#DC143C) at a CIE76 distance of 19.7, which is visibly different.
